"THE HEIGHTS OF THIS SPLENDID BARRIER ARE INACCESSIBLE TO MAN": WHITE'S VIEWS IN INDIA, WITH 37 FINE ENGRAVED FOLIO VIEWS OF THE HIMALAYAN REGION OF INDIA

(INDIA) WHITE, George Francis. Views in India, Chiefly Among the Himalaya Mountains. London & Paris: Fisher, Son, 1838. Folio (10-1/2 by 12-1/2 inches), contemporary full burgundy morocco, gilt vignette to covers, raised bands, all edges gilt.

Early edition, illustrated with an engraved title page vignette and 37 evocative full-page steel-engraved views of Indian mountain scenes, villages and temples, seven of which were drawn for engraving, from White's original sketches, by J.M.W. Turner.

This work includes "description of the rocks in the Ganges and Sutlej, the Keeree pass, Hardwar, Mussoorie, Jamnotri, Gangotri, Nahaun, including an account of the ascent of Choor" (Kaul 751). The exquisite plates depict various scenes of the Ganges River, the Snowy Range of the Himalayas, Gungootree the Sacred Source of the Ganges, and the Valley of the Dhoon, among others. George Francis White (1808-98) served in the British Army, and was in India with the 31st Regiment of Foot from 1825-46. He fought in the Sutlej campaign of 1846 including the battles of Mudki and Ferozeshah. White was a skillful amateur artist and many of his drawings were engraved. His drawings were used by Robert Burford for a panorama of the Himalayas exhibited at Leicester Square in 1847. First published 1836; this copy with engraved title page dated 1838. Contemporary owner ink signature dated 1840 of Thomas Theophilus Hawkey (1792-1851), Attorney of Trewollack, St. Wenn, Cornwall.

Without front free endpaper (blank); inner paper hinges cracked, but holding firm. Only occasional faint foxing. Contemporary morocco handsome and fine. A very nice copy.
